Splunk ServiceNow Integration encrypting data?

larryggibson
Explorer

We have installed the ServiceNow integration in our splunk instance and are getting data through from our Snow instance. We have noticed that some fields seem to be encrypted. Is this something we need to change on the ServiceNow side or is it something we need to change on the Splunk integration? An example would be cmdb_ci looks like this cmdb_ci=f97dcb156fdd1140436a5afc5d3ee4cf

Not encrypting data at all but showing reference values rather than display values. Now if I go only figure out how to get splunk integration to fix this. Reference Snow wiki look for Direct Web Services section 5 for detail. Can't include link no karma.
